The average (mean) amount of time that a manager at the Cimaron Valley 7.2 Department of Human Services spends in the annual performance review with an employee is 31.3 minutes, with a standard deviation of 5.7 minutes (normal distribution). What percentage of the annual performance reviews in the depart- ment take between 24.9 and 36.1 minutes? Between 26.4 and 30.6 minutes? Between 32.0 and 37.5 minutes? What percentage of the annual performance reviews take more than 40 minutes? What percentage take less than 20 minutes?
Continuous Probability Distributions
Probability distributions are of two types, which are continuous probability distributions and discrete probability distributions. A continuous probability distribution contains an infinite number of values. For example, if time is infinite: you could count from 0 to a trillion seconds, billion seconds, so on indefinitely. A discrete probability distribution consists of only a countable set of possible values.
